Core Perspective - The narrative illustrates a transformation in perception regarding the river birch tree, highlighting how initial dislike can shift to appreciation through the observation of its ecological value, particularly in attracting various bird species during winter [2][3]. Group 1: Initial Dislike - The river birch tree is described as having a chaotic appearance, with a disordered shape and unattractive bark, leading to a strong dislike from the observer [1]. - The tree's location near the dining area exacerbates the negative feelings, as it detracts from the aesthetic enjoyment of meals [1]. Group 2: Change in Perception - A winter morning experience reveals a multitude of birds, including rare species, gathering on the river birch tree, which transforms the observer's view of the tree from negative to positive [2]. - The presence of birds brings life to the previously dull and lifeless tree, showcasing its role in the local ecosystem and enhancing the observer's appreciation for it [2][3]. Group 3: Lasting Impact - The observer's emotional response shifts significantly, leading to a newfound joy in the presence of the river birch tree, illustrating the importance of perspective in appreciating nature [3].
